Transaction d67b90e14364321c36aa4fe7d9fcdf6929791750e93ee2e87bc30266b415194a
1 Input
1 Output
-
d67b90e14364321c36aa4fe7d9fcdf6929791750e93ee2e87bc30266b415194a:0
- value
- 630021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abec8bf9fcfcde04dc6b7ed87b856a6d8f166eab OP_EQUAL
- address
- 3HN4quTzSicq7SnupUBako5MJRZyG2HbUL